Before we look at where to watch it, let's revisit why Malamaal Weekly remains a fan favorite. Directed by the comedy maestro Priyadarshan, the film was released in 2006 and became a major box-office success, grossing over ₹42 crore against a modest budget of just ₹7 crore.

Released in 2006, Malamaal Weekly isn't just a movie; it’s a masterclass in situational comedy. Set in the impoverished village of Laholi, the story kicks off when Lilaram (Paresh Rawal) discovers that one of the lottery tickets he sold is a jackpot winner. The catch? The winner is dead.
